直播APP原理(直播的原理和运行机制)

直播APP原理(直播的原理和运行机制)

直播互动goubuli2024-09-19 4:33:181A+A-

本文目录一览:

实现直播APP开发技术难点在哪

弱网络下保证视频质量 弱网络,指的是网络信号弱,即使在WIFI环境下,用户也经常会发生信号不好需要缓存的情况,更别说4G/3G的网络情况下了,不过5G时代马上就要来临,相信这一问题届时会有更好的技术来解决。页面交互动画 互动直播的内在就是主播与用户的一个互动过程。

程序本身有bug 具体问题需要根据程序员排查结果而定,由于本篇探讨的是直播软件搭建问题,而非程序本身的问题,因此该问题不展开作答 用户端网络及手机硬件不足 不属于“直播APP搭建”的问题,用户切换网络或更新手机版本、购买新手机后即可解决。

难点不在于美颜效果,而在于GPU占用和美颜效果之间找平衡。GPU虽然性能好,但是也是有功耗的,GPU占用太高会导致手机发烫,而直播过程中手机发烫会导致摄像头采集掉帧,iPhone6尤其明显,因为iPhone6的CPU和前置摄像头很近。

直播APP的开发相比于手机APP来说难点还是比较多的,所以在选择开发公司上面谨慎多问是必须的,想要知道视频直播APP开发公司哪家好,就还是建议找有直播视频开发经验的公司,毕竟已经有过开发经验,在开发上相比于那些没经验的来说开发周期也会快很多。

直播app是怎么开发的,视频直播的产品结构是什么样的

1、首先,视频直播app的产品结构说到底其实是以服务器作为信息的载体,将它作为主播端和用户端的桥梁,进行数据的传输。其次,在主播端进行音视频的采集、前处理、编码等这其中涉及到降噪除杂、美颜等优化手段;而在用户端需要进行数据解码和渲染这其中涉及到缓冲控制、语音画质同步来提高用户体验。

2、决定产品功能 产品的基础功能如:多渠道登录/支付/分享、拍摄直播、私信、评论、关注、多分类列表、发礼物、抢红包、多种房间设置、美颜等功能是一定要有的,至于短视频、商城等功能是可以酌情根据产品定位进行选择性开发的。

3、如上题所示,这一种推拉流架构方式需要依赖腾讯这类厂商提供的手机互动直播SDK,通过在主播端APP和用户端APP都集成SDK,使得主播端和用户端都拥有推拉流的功能。

直播流程管理系统

直播平台搭建过程一般可以分为采集、前处理、编码、传输、解码、渲染这几个环节,经过这几个环,视频直播的过程一般可以分为采集、前处理、编码、传输、解码、渲染这几个环节,经过这几个环节之后,我们就可以通过PC端或者移动端进行视频直播的观看。

映客公会管理系统是一款适用于直播公会的客户关系管理软件,其主要功能是维护公会与主播之间的联系,加强公会对主播的管理与培养,提高公会的影响力和收益。该系统除了常见的客户关系管理功能外,还能够实现资金管理、数据分析、流量监控、消息推送等一系列功能,让公会管理者在日常运营中更加便捷、高效。

第一种方法是,自己召集人马,如果您资金雄厚,或您本身是一名技术,且有其他技术朋友的话,可以尝试和朋友一起自行搭建视频直播系统,人数的话大约需要五组人,包括产品组、IOS组、安卓组、后台组、测试组等等,人寿和资金都充足的话,大约八个月左右就能搞定。

好用的erp管理系统列举如下:用友U8 用友U8成长型企业互联网应用平台,为成长型企业提供预配置的最佳管理与业务实践,以企业全面精细化管理方案为核心,融入互联网时代的新兴元素:移动技术、网络营销、电子商务、体验营销,帮助企业实现产业链协同,推进企业经营管理模式变革,助力企业基业长青。

负责招募、拓展、挖掘、培养和管理网络主播,整理主播资料,构建主播团队。 发掘潜力主播,维护现有主播,协助运营部门引导主播入驻直播平台。 处理主播的咨询、投诉和建议,提供有效解决方案。 协助优化主播招募和管理流程,建立和谐的主播管理制度。

视频直播App搭建的音视频采集和处理

媒体模块:负责视频采集、编码、传输和解码等功能,确保直播内容的质量和流畅度。 信令控制:处理直播连接的建立、维护和断开,以及传输控制信号,如开始/停止直播、切换摄像头等。 登录与鉴权:用户身份验证,确保直播APP的安全性,区分不同用户的角色和权限。

作为直播平台搭建中的核心功能,音视频处理的一般流程:直播客户端分为两个端:共享端和观看端。其中共享端又包含:音视频采集,音视频编码两个模块,我们需要对每个模块做的事情非常清楚。音视频采集:摄像机及拾音器收集视频及音频数据,此时得到的为原始数据涉及技术或协议。

揭秘视频直播系统的搭建之路:全方位解析关键环节视频直播的诞生,如同一场科技的盛宴,其背后涉及采集、前处理、编码、传输、解码、渲染等多个复杂的步骤。让我们逐一探索,如何构建一个完整的视频直播系统,让直播体验如丝般顺畅。

首先,视频直播app的产品结构说到底其实是以服务器作为信息的载体,将它作为主播端和用户端的桥梁,进行数据的传输。其次,在主播端进行音视频的采集、前处理、编码等这其中涉及到降噪除杂、美颜等优化手段;而在用户端需要进行数据解码和渲染这其中涉及到缓冲控制、语音画质同步来提高用户体验。

建立一个视频直播系统分为采集,前处理,编码,传输,解码,渲染 这几个环节,下面分别说下:采集,iOS是比较简单的,Android则要做些机型适配工作,PC最麻烦各种奇葩摄像头驱动,出了问题特别不好处理,建议放弃PC只支持手机主播,目前几个新进的直播平台都是这样的。

直播类视频App软件怎么开发(直播软件怎么做)

资金:开发一个视频直播APP首先需要资金,有钱才能开发出属于自己的视频直播APP;公司资质:营业执照。

进行视频直播APP开发需要经过以下步骤:**需求分析:**定义视频直播APP的功能和特性,明确目标受众,确定基本需求。**竞品分析:**研究市场上已有的视频直播APP,了解它们的优势和不足,找到差异化亮点。**技术选型:**选择适合项目的技术栈,包括前端开发、后端开发、数据库选择等。

视频直播系统:在线用户数和消息量无限制、海量消息并发即,时到达,实时互动稳定流畅无卡顿。实时互动系统:即时聊天、评论、收藏、分享、点赞、送礼、红包、弹幕等。特效美颜:自带美颜、瘦脸等功能,加强用户观看购物直播的视觉体验,提升用户购买欲望。

直播移动APP开发注意点一:保证视频直播质量 直播APP软件开发为了保证在网络信号弱的情况下,避免用户如果经常会发生信号不好需要缓存的情况,否则会大大降低用户体验。

内容分发系统 关于内容分发,就需要讲到CDN。它可以在多个节点服务器之间将直播内容进行自动分发,从而实现全网播放,并且移动终端用户可以自动选择离自己近的服务节点来接受发布内容。如果想要开发的直播软件业务范围是全国,那么就需要找一家覆盖全国节点的服务商,这样才能够保证直播业务的正常进行。

怎样开发一款直播类app

开发一款直播类app可以参考以下几点:保证视频直播质量 直播APP软件开发为了保证在网络信号弱的情况下,避免用户如果经常会发生信号不好需要缓存的情况,否则会大大降低用户体验。

视频直播功能,这是一款直播App最主要的功能,要能支持视频直播RTMP推流,使画面传输流畅、清晰美颜后的清晰。聊天功能,用户之间的互动聊天,包括文字和表情。互动功能,用户与主播间的互动,点亮个灯,送一束花等等。

资金:开发一个视频直播APP首先需要资金,有钱才能开发出属于自己的视频直播APP。公司资质:营业执照。开发视频直播APP需要用到一些第三方,如第三方社交平台登录、微信、支付宝支付、银联支付等,您不用不行,您总不能自己做个支付平台吧,这些第三方的申请无疑都需要公司资质,也就是营业执照。

点击这里复制本文地址 以上内容由ZBLOG整理呈现,请务必在转载分享时注明本文地址!如对内容有疑问,请联系我们,谢谢!

支持Ctrl+Enter提交
qrcode

慎秋网 © All Rights Reserved.  
Powered by Z-BlogPHP Themes by yiwuku.com
联系我们| 关于我们| 留言建议| 网站管理